If you appreciate the lush, green landscapes and historical charm of Forest Park in Springfield, you'll find a similar vibe in Phoenix's Encanto neighborhood. Encanto Park offers ample outdoor spaces and is a hit among families for its golf course and lagoon. For those drawn to the historical and vibrant community of McKnight, Coronado in Phoenix mirrors this with its collection of historic homes and hip eateries like The Main Ingredient Ale House and Cafe. Meanwhile, Sixteen Acres' spacious suburban charm is closely matched by Ahwatukee Foothills in Phoenix, known for its serene living, golf courses, and highly rated schools like Kyrene de los Cerritos School. 1. Midtown Phoenix: Known for its walkable streets and numerous pet-friendly patios, your furry friends will love the welcoming atmosphere and Rosie McCaffrey’s Irish Pub for a bite where pets are happily seen on the patio.

2. Arcadia: This neighborhood is a paradise for pets with spacious backyards and close proximity to Camelback Mountain for adventurous walks and hikes, making it perfect for active dogs.

3. Roosevelt Row: This artsy district not only welcomes pets in many galleries and cafes but also hosts pet-centric events like the annual Phoestivus market, making it an incredibly fun and engaging community for pet lovers.

Moving from Springfield, MA, to Phoenix, AZ, one of the most noticeable changes you'll encounter is the temperature and humidity levels. Springfield experiences a significant range of temperatures throughout the year with a noticeable humidity, while Phoenix boasts a dryer climate with much higher temperatures, especially in summer. The abundant sunshine in Phoenix can be a major draw but also demands precautions against sun exposure and heat-related issues. The stark difference in annual rainfall and snowfall underscores the need for adapting your lifestyle and possibly your wardrobe to match Phoenix's more arid conditions. While the average commute time in both Springfield and Phoenix might be similar, the experience of getting around in these cities varies significantly due to differences in traffic congestion and public transit options. In Springfield, with lower traffic congestion, your commute might feel less stressful compared to Phoenix, where traffic can be heavier. Additionally, Springfield offers moderately reliable public transit, making it somewhat feasible to get by without a car, unlike in Phoenix, where a car is almost indispensable due to lesser availability of public transit options.
